Carver Langston, Washington, DC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Carver Langston?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Carver Langston Studio Apartments | $1,618 | $1,349 | $2,150 |
| Carver Langston 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,906 | $1,036 | $2,937 |
| Carver Langston 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,637 | $1,314 | $5,015 |
| Carver Langston 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,133 | $2,275 | $7,117 |
| Carver Langston 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,400 | $5,400 | $5,400 |
